“Therefore, go and make disciples of all nations, baptizing them in the name of the Father and of the Son and of the Holy Spirit.” Matthew 28:19

 

As we about to step into the new month, it’s a wonderful opportunity to reflect on the countless ways God has moved in our lives. Like a gardener who prepares the soil for spring sowing, we can cultivate our spirits, readying ourselves to share the abundant blessings we’ve received. When we engage with others, whether through small acts of kindness or grand gestures, we sow seeds that can flourish and grow into a beautiful harvest.

 

Think of the story of the Good Samaritan (Luke 10:25-37), who didn’t hesitate to help a stranger in need. His heart was filled with compassion, and he modeled what it means to truly love our neighbors. Imagine how transformative it would be if we all committed to being Good Samaritans in our daily lives — offering our time, our talents, and our resources. Each greeting, each smile, each act of service can ripple out like stones cast into a pond, reaching far beyond our immediate surroundings.

 

2 Corinthians 9:10-11 says, “Now he who supplies seed to the Sower and bread for food will also supply and increase your store of seed and will enlarge the harvest of your righteousness. You will be enriched in every way so that you can be generous on every occasion, and through us, your generosity will result in thanksgiving to God.”

 

In 2 Corinthians 9:10-11, we are reminded that God supplies seed to the Sower. Just as a farmer trusts the earth to yield a harvest, so too can we trust that our efforts to bless others will bear fruit. With every kind word or action, we are participating in a divine exchange, where the more we give, the more we receive — in joy, fulfillment, and spiritual abundance.

 

As we move forward together, let us keep our hearts open and our hands ready to serve. Together, we can weave a tapestry of kindness that reflects God’s glory in our communities. Remember Matthew 28:19-20, where we’re called to make disciples of all nations. So this coming month, let’s take that command to heart. Whether through sharing your faith or simply offering encouragement, you have the power to affect lives around you. Amen. Proverbs 11:25 says, “Whoever brings blessing will be enriched, and one who waters will himself be watered.” Amen.
